黑狐家游戏

常见的虚拟化类型有哪些方面,揭秘虚拟化技术,探索常见的虚拟化类型及其应用

欧气 0 0

本文目录导读:

  1. 常见的虚拟化类型

随着云计算、大数据等新兴技术的快速发展,虚拟化技术已成为IT行业的关键技术之一,虚拟化技术通过将物理硬件资源转化为虚拟资源,实现资源的灵活分配和高效利用,本文将详细介绍常见的虚拟化类型,并探讨其应用场景。

常见的虚拟化类型

1、完全虚拟化

常见的虚拟化类型有哪些方面,揭秘虚拟化技术,探索常见的虚拟化类型及其应用

图片来源于网络,如有侵权联系删除

完全虚拟化(Full Virtualization)是指将物理硬件资源完全抽象化,创建出多个虚拟机(VM),每个虚拟机都具有独立的操作系统和硬件配置,常见的完全虚拟化技术有VMware、Xen等。

应用场景:

(1)异构硬件平台:完全虚拟化技术可以支持不同硬件平台的虚拟化,方便跨平台迁移。

(2)资源隔离:通过虚拟化技术,可以实现对不同业务系统的资源隔离,提高系统安全性。

(3)快速部署:虚拟化技术可以快速创建和部署虚拟机,提高业务系统的上线速度。

2、超虚拟化

超虚拟化(Para-Virtualization)是指虚拟机与物理硬件之间通过一组虚拟化的接口进行交互,虚拟机操作系统需要支持超虚拟化技术,常见的超虚拟化技术有KVM、OpenVZ等。

应用场景:

(1)高性能:超虚拟化技术具有较高的性能,适用于对资源性能要求较高的业务系统。

常见的虚拟化类型有哪些方面,揭秘虚拟化技术,探索常见的虚拟化类型及其应用

图片来源于网络,如有侵权联系删除

(2)资源控制:超虚拟化技术可以对虚拟机的资源进行精细控制,提高资源利用率。

(3)低成本:超虚拟化技术通常开源免费,降低了企业成本。

3、半虚拟化

半虚拟化(Half Virtualization)是指虚拟机与物理硬件之间通过虚拟化的接口进行交互,但虚拟机操作系统需要部分修改以支持虚拟化,常见的半虚拟化技术有Hyper-V、Xen等。

应用场景:

(1)高性能:半虚拟化技术具有较高的性能,适用于对资源性能要求较高的业务系统。

(2)资源隔离:通过虚拟化技术,可以实现对不同业务系统的资源隔离,提高系统安全性。

(3)兼容性:半虚拟化技术支持多种操作系统,具有较好的兼容性。

4、OS虚拟化

常见的虚拟化类型有哪些方面,揭秘虚拟化技术,探索常见的虚拟化类型及其应用

图片来源于网络,如有侵权联系删除

OS虚拟化(Operating System Virtualization)是指在宿主机操作系统的基础上,通过虚拟化技术创建多个虚拟环境,实现资源的隔离和高效利用,常见的OS虚拟化技术有Docker、LXC等。

应用场景:

(1)容器化部署:OS虚拟化技术可以快速创建和部署容器,提高业务系统的上线速度。

(2)资源隔离:通过虚拟化技术,可以实现对不同业务系统的资源隔离,提高系统安全性。

(3)轻量级:OS虚拟化技术具有轻量级的特点,降低了系统资源消耗。

虚拟化技术作为一种重要的IT技术,在云计算、大数据等新兴领域发挥着重要作用,本文介绍了常见的虚拟化类型及其应用场景,旨在帮助读者更好地了解虚拟化技术,为实际应用提供参考,随着虚拟化技术的不断发展,相信其在未来将会发挥更加重要的作用。

标签: #常见的虚拟化类型有哪些

黑狐家游戏
  • 评论列表

留言评论